Property Amenities
Dining options at the hotel include a restaurant. A bar/lounge is on site where guests can unwind with a drink. This 4-star property offers access to secretarial services, a meeting/conference room, and small meeting rooms.
This design hotel also offers a fitness facility, a rooftop terrace, and a concierge desk. Limited onsite parking is available on a first-come, first-served basis (surcharge).
Rooms
Air-conditioned accommodations at Barcelo Aran Blu offer minibars and safes. Rooms open to balconies. Satellite television is provided. Bathrooms include bathrobes, designer toiletries, bidets, and phones.
In-room wireless high-speed Internet access is available for a surcharge. Business-friendly amenities include desks and direct-dial phones. Additionally, rooms include hair dryers and windows that open.

Ostia - Pomezia, Italy: Lying 31 kilometres southwest of Rome, Lido di Ostia this is Romes seafront. Most of the busy beach is privatised, so there is a surcharge for use and loungers and parasols. The jewel of the area is nearby Ostia Antica. The architectural site gives a fascinating insight into the everyday life of sailors, merchants and slaves dating to the fourth century B.C. It later became Ancient Romes port for 600 years.
